テスト自動化
パワーエレクトロニクスのテストは、安全性、性能、そして規制要件を満たすために不可欠です。これにより、メーカーとエンドユーザーの両方にメリットをもたらす、信頼性が高く、高品質で競争力のある製品が生まれます。この分野における自動テストは、特に有益なプロセスであり、時間がかかり、エラーが発生しやすい手動テストと比較して、テストケースをより迅速かつ効率的に実行できます。
制御ソフトウェアの複雑化、製品および性能統合仕様の高度化、そして規制遵守の強化に伴い、パワーエレクトロニクスのテストはますます複雑化し、コストと時間を要するようになっています。さらに、リソースの制約と開発サイクルの短縮化へのプレッシャーも重なり、企業はプロセスのアップグレードを躊躇し、より広範なソフトウェアテスト・エコシステムへのアクセスを制限する、カスタム開発によるレガシーなテスト自動化ソリューションに依存しています。

パワーエレクトロニクスのテストを自動化する際に懸念される点の一つは、人間の監視なしに安全なテストを自動で実行できるかどうかです。コントローラハードウェアインザループ(C-HIL) この問題に対処するには、電力段を方程式から除外します。HILを導入すれば、監視なしのテストを安全に実行できるため、テストの自動化は自然な次のステップとなります。
自動テストスクリプトは、製品ライフサイクルのメンテナンスにおいて不可欠な要素となります。そのため、新しいテストの作成と既存のテストのメンテナンスを迅速化できるテストフレームワークを選択することが重要です。自動テストの結果の可視化は、問題の特定を迅速化し、製品のパフォーマンスに関する洞察を得るための鍵となります。テスト手順をコード形式で記述することで、柔軟性が向上し、バージョン管理や変更の検査が容易になります。
Typhoon HILは、HILシミュレーションプラットフォームを用いたパワーエレクトロニクスおよびエネルギーシステムのテストと検証に特化した、テスト自動化製品とサービスのスイートを提供しています。当社のソフトウェアツールとスクリプトを使用して、シミュレートされたハードウェア上でテストをセットアップ、制御、実行することで、より効率的で徹底的なテストプロセスが可能になります。TyphoonTestを使用すると、テストを迅速に記述し、詳細なレポートを生成できます。Typhoon Test Hubを使用すると、これらのテストを他のプロセスと統合し、生成されたすべての結果を管理できます。
- 当社の Python API を使用すると、デバイスのファームウェアの更新やモデルの作成から、シミュレーションの実行、システムの変更まで、Typhoon ツール チェーン全体を完全に制御できます。
- PytestベースのテストフレームワークTyphoonTestで、テスト作成速度を向上させましょう。HILシミュレーションのテストシナリオ、入力条件、期待される出力を定義するカスタムスクリプトを作成できます。詳細なレポートが自動的に作成されます。
- Typhoon Test Hubを使えば、あらゆるテストインフラストラクチャとレポートを簡単に管理できます。テストインフラストラクチャの可視性と洞察力を高め、数千ものテスト結果を最大限に活用できます。
- 新機能の導入など、製品に付加価値をつけるために人材を投入しましょう。反復テスト、特に回帰テストは自動化する必要があります。
- 包括的な回帰テストは、変更による無関係な(そして望ましくない)影響を特定するのに役立ちます。テストを頻繁に実行し、バグを早期に修正しましょう。
- HIL テストを継続的インテグレーションおよび継続的デリバリー (CI/CD) パイプラインに統合し、新しい開発が展開前に徹底的にテストされるようにします。
- 特定の顧客のニーズに合わせてカスタマイズされたテスト ケースを開発し、顧客独自の製品またはシステムの効率的かつ信頼性の高いテストを可能にします。
効率的、正確、かつスケーラブルな製品でチームを強化し、Typhoon HIL でテストを自動化します。